Warm-up effects: which statements are observed?

Explanation:
Warming up prepares the body in several integrated ways, so you typically see multiple observable effects rather than just one. Enhanced neural function occurs because warming tissues improves nerve conduction velocity and motor-unit recruitment, which translates to quicker reaction times and more precise, forceful contractions. At the same time, oxygen use rises during a warm-up; the cardiovascular system increases output to meet the higher metabolic demand, so baseline oxygen consumption remains elevated for a short period after the warm-up, helping the body transition more smoothly into exercise. Muscle temperature increases as well, which speeds up enzymatic reactions, improves cross-bridge cycling, and makes muscles more pliable, contributing to faster, more powerful movements with less resistance to movement. Because all of these changes can be observed with a proper warm-up, the best answer is that all of the above are seen.
